From 020601ea0abeb15f2aef9da354fcf6d7d5459710 Mon Sep 17 00:00:00 2001 From: =?utf8?q?G=C3=BCnther=20Deschner?= Date: Tue, 27 Feb 2007 13:25:42 +0000 Subject: [PATCH] r21556: Remove superfluos return check in ads_keytab_verify_ticket(). Guenther --- source/libads/kerberos_verify.c | 2 -- 1 file changed, 2 deletions(-) diff --git a/source/libads/kerberos_verify.c b/source/libads/kerberos_verify.c index dc2f2a1e788..03e30a9ba3e 100644 --- a/source/libads/kerberos_verify.c +++ b/source/libads/kerberos_verify.c @@ -88,7 +88,6 @@ static BOOL ads_keytab_verify_ticket(krb5_context context, krb5_auth_context aut goto out; } - if (ret != KRB5_KT_END && ret != ENOENT ) { while (!auth_ok && (krb5_kt_next_entry(context, keytab, &kt_entry, &kt_cursor) == 0)) { ret = smb_krb5_unparse_name(context, kt_entry.principal, &entry_princ_s); if (ret) { @@ -146,7 +145,6 @@ static BOOL ads_keytab_verify_ticket(krb5_context context, krb5_auth_context aut ZERO_STRUCT(kt_entry); } krb5_kt_end_seq_get(context, keytab, &kt_cursor); - } ZERO_STRUCT(kt_cursor); -- 2.11.4.GIT